WebIn year 2024, a reorganization of Jeil Forging Far East (JFFE) took place. All sales, marketing, sourcing and R & D activities of JFFE – including semi-finished parts, casting, thread protectors and forgings were consolidated under Dura-Metal Group. Main forging production activities remain in South Korea.
